RAG Image If you’ve spent any time with ChatGPT, Claude, or any large language model, you’ve probably run into this moment: you ask a specific question about your business, your industry, or a recent event, and the AI gives you an answer that sounds completely confident — and is completely wrong. This isn’t a bug you can patch. It’s a structural limitation of how large language models work
